Both promise to save Britain from Labour
Scottish Daily Express
|January 17, 2026
KEMI Badenoch and Robert Jenrick have each vowed to rescue Britain from Labour's grip following their explosive split.
In duelling articles for the Express, both promised to fight for the UK's future after one of Westminster's most dramatic days. Turmoil erupted on Thursday when Shadow Cabinet minister Mr Jenrick defected to Reform UK, hours after Mrs Badenoch sacked him live on social media.
The leader of the Tories writes today: "Conservatives know Britain cannot be fixed with slogans or grievance politics. It will be fixed with credible, conservative solutions.
"I will not talk this country down when I know how great it can be. I will tell the truth about what is broken - and then I will fix it.
"Britain has faced harder moments than this and emerged stronger every time.
"Labour are making a terrible mess of the country but, as we have done throughout history, I am confident the Conservative Party will be ready to clean up that mess. We have the team, the plans and the experience to ensure we can get Britain working again."
Mr Jenrick insisted his defection to Nigel Farage was "uniting the Right" as he said he had put the country before his allegiance to the Tories. The former immigration minister said: "My decision to defect to Reform was difficult, but it was undoubtedly the right one. I fought to get the Conservative Party to change, first as a leadership candidate and then from within the Shadow Cabinet.
